Definitions
The term anomalistic refers to something that is anomalous or deviates from the norm. It is used to describe something that is irregular or unusual. In scientific terms, it is used to describe the orbit of a planet or a comet that is not circular but elliptical.
Origin
The word anomalistic comes from the Greek word “anomalos,” which means irregular or uneven. The word “anomalistic” was first used in the 17th century to describe the irregularity of the orbits of planets.

Synonyms
Some synonyms of anomalistic include abnormal, irregular, atypical, peculiar, and unusual.
Antonyms
The antonyms of anomalistic include normal, regular, typical, and standard.
The same root words
The root word of anomalistic is “anomalous,” which means deviating from what is standard, normal, or expected.
